Multiple plasma metals, genetic risk and serum C-reactive protein: A metal-metal and gene-metal interaction study
9 Dec 2019
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: C-reactive protein (CRP) is a well-recognized biomarker of inflammation, which can be used as a predictor of cardiovascular disease. Evidence have suggested exposure to multiple metals/metalloids may affect immune system and give rise to cardiovascular disease. However, it is lack of study to comprehensively evaluate the association of multiple metals and CRP, the interactions between metals, and the...
